Output fc93c40cfc6486bd350f3cc2e2c8273cb5972da6406da1618e950f71bb52d73f:0

value
306801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b91b8923683742d55ec787fc16671af14912ba OP_EQUAL
address
358Ug96H8MeeZo5RTsVmK9C6SG4yMBNgrU
transaction
fc93c40cfc6486bd350f3cc2e2c8273cb5972da6406da1618e950f71bb52d73f
confirmations
427643
spent
true